LayerZero Attributes $290 Million Kelp Exploit to Inadequate Security Setup and North Korea's Lazarus Group
LayerZero has attributed the $290 million exploit of Kelp DAO to the protocol's single-verifier configuration, which disregarded the company's recommendations for a multi-verifier setup. The attackers, believed to be associated with North Korea's Lazarus Group, compromised two RPC nodes relied upon by LayerZero's verifier and launched a DDoS attack on other nodes to force a failover. This attack vector, targeting the infrastructure layer rather than protocol code, allowed the attackers to deceive LayerZero's verifier into releasing 116,500 rsETH. The success of the attack was contingent upon Kelp's decision to operate a 1-of-1 verifier configuration, contrary to LayerZero's advice for redundancy through multiple verifiers. LayerZero has confirmed that the attack did not affect any other applications on the protocol and has since taken measures to prevent similar incidents by refusing to sign messages for applications with single-verifier setups. The distinction between a protocol-level bug and a configuration failure is crucial for assessing LayerZero risk, with the latter implying that the protocol functioned as designed and the security lapse was due to Kelp's choices.
